The Mechanics of the Perfect Grill

So, what makes a perfectly grilled Porterhouse steak? The answer lies in the perfect balance of temperature, cooking time, and technique.

Here are the 5 key steps to cooking a perfectly grilled Porterhouse steak:

  1. Choose the right cut of meat: Look for a Porterhouse steak that is at least 1.5 inches thick and has a good marbling score.

  2. Select the right cooking oil: Use a high- smoke-point oil like avocado or grapeseed oil to prevent the steak from burning.

  3. Preheat the grill: Heat the grill to medium-high heat (around 400°F) and make sure it’s clean and well-oiled.

  4. Season the steak: Rub the steak with a mixture of salt, pepper, and your favorite herbs and spices, and let it sit for at least 30 minutes to allow the seasonings to penetrate the meat.

  5. Grill the steak: Sear the steak for 3-4 minutes per side, then reduce the heat to medium-low and continue cooking for an additional 10-15 minutes, or until it reaches your desired level of doneness.

Addressing Common Curiosities

One of the most common questions when it comes to grilling a Porterhouse steak is how to achieve the perfect sear while preventing the steak from burning.

Another common concern is how to cook the steak to the perfect level of doneness, without overcooking the edges or undercooking the center.

Finally, many people wonder about the best type of cooking oil to use when grilling a Porterhouse steak, and how to prevent the steak from sticking to the grill.

Here are some tips to address these common concerns:

For a perfect sear, make sure the grill is hot and well-oiled before adding the steak. You can also use a cast-iron or stainless steel grill pan to achieve a crispy sear.

For the perfect level of doneness, use a meat thermometer to check the internal temperature of the steak. For medium-rare, the internal temperature should be around 130-135°F, while for medium, it should be around 140-145°F.

For the best type of cooking oil, use a high-smoke-point oil like avocado or grapeseed oil. You can also add a small amount of oil to the grill pan before adding the steak to prevent it from sticking.
